Output 85de233cbac3980ded0078ad8fe4040807c0f618ddc972b33551847c6b1f1cb1:16

value
15117944
script pubkey
OP_0 OP_PUSHBYTES_20 baf9d2dcba127587ca0156aeb106023a92be0b8f
address
bc1qhtua9h96zf6c0jsp26htzpsz82ftuzu0hjn9m6
transaction
85de233cbac3980ded0078ad8fe4040807c0f618ddc972b33551847c6b1f1cb1